Why Choose Cloud-Based IT Solutions for Your Business?
Cloud-based IT solutions are transforming how businesses operate. Instead of relying on traditional on-premises servers and hardware, cloud solutions allow you to access computing resources over the internet. This shift brings several advantages:
Cost Savings: You pay only for what you use, avoiding large upfront investments in hardware.
Scalability: Easily scale your resources up or down based on demand.
Accessibility: Access your data and applications from anywhere, anytime.
Security: Benefit from advanced security measures managed by cloud providers.
Disaster Recovery: Quickly recover data in case of unexpected events.
For growing businesses, these benefits translate into faster decision-making, improved collaboration, and the ability to adapt quickly to market changes. Plus, cloud solutions reduce the burden on your internal IT team, letting them focus on strategic initiatives rather than routine maintenance.

What are cloud IT services?
Cloud IT services refer to a broad range of computing services delivered over the internet. These include storage, servers, databases, networking, software, analytics, and intelligence. Instead of owning and maintaining physical infrastructure, you rent these services from cloud providers.
Here are some common types of cloud IT services:
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S): Provides virtualized computing resources like servers and storage.
Platform as a Service (PaaS): Offers a platform allowing developers to build, test, and deploy applications without managing infrastructure.
Software as a Service (SaaS): Delivers software applications over the internet on a subscription basis.
By leveraging these services, businesses can reduce complexity, improve agility, and focus on core activities. For example, a marketing team can use SaaS tools for campaign management without worrying about software updates or compatibility issues.
How to Implement Cloud-Based IT Solutions Effectively
Adopting cloud-based IT solutions is not just about technology; it’s about strategy and execution. Here’s a step-by-step approach to help you get started:
1. Assess Your Current IT Environment
Begin by understanding your existing infrastructure, applications, and workflows. Identify pain points such as slow performance, high costs, or security risks. This assessment will help you determine which parts of your IT can benefit most from cloud migration.
2. Define Your Business Goals
Clarify what you want to achieve with cloud solutions. Are you aiming to improve collaboration, enhance security, or reduce downtime? Setting clear goals ensures your cloud strategy aligns with your business objectives.
3. Choose the Right Cloud Model
Decide between public, private, or hybrid cloud models based on your needs:
Public Cloud: Services offered over the public internet, ideal for scalability and cost-effectiveness.
Private Cloud: Dedicated infrastructure for your organization, offering enhanced security.
Hybrid Cloud: Combines both, allowing flexibility and control.
4. Select Trusted Cloud Providers
Partner with reputable cloud providers who offer reliable services, strong security, and excellent support. Look for providers with certifications and compliance relevant to your industry.
5. Plan Your Migration
Develop a detailed migration plan that includes timelines, resource allocation, and risk management. Consider starting with non-critical applications to minimize disruption.
6. Train Your Team
Ensure your staff understands how to use new cloud tools effectively. Training reduces resistance and maximizes the benefits of cloud adoption.
7. Monitor and Optimize
After migration, continuously monitor performance, security, and costs. Use analytics to optimize your cloud environment and adapt to changing business needs.
Overcoming Common Challenges in Cloud Adoption
While cloud-based IT solutions offer many benefits, transitioning to the cloud can come with challenges. Here’s how to tackle some common obstacles:
Data Security Concerns: Work with providers that offer robust encryption, multi-factor authentication, and compliance certifications. Regularly update your security policies.
Integration Issues: Ensure your cloud services can integrate smoothly with existing systems. Use APIs and middleware to bridge gaps.
Cost Management: Monitor usage to avoid unexpected expenses. Use budgeting tools and set alerts for unusual activity.
Change Management: Communicate clearly with your team about the benefits and changes. Provide ongoing support and training.
Downtime Risks: Choose providers with strong uptime guarantees and disaster recovery plans.
By proactively addressing these challenges, you can ensure a smooth transition and maximize the value of your cloud investment.
